Manual transmission

When shifting into 5th or 6th gear, press
the gearshift to the right. Otherwise, an

inadvertent shift into 3rd or 4th gear could harm
the engine.

<

Reverse

Select only when the vehicle is stationary. Press
the gearshift lever to the left to overcome the
resistance.

Automatic transmission with

Steptronic*

In addition to fully automatic operation, you can
also manually shift with the Steptronic, refer to
page

39

.

Parking vehicle

To prevent the vehicle from rolling,
always select position P and engage the

handbrake before leaving the vehicle with the
engine running.

<

Selector lever positions

P R N D M/S + –

Engine started

The engine can only be started in selector lever
positions P: Park or N: Neutral.

Displays in the instrument cluster

P R N D SD M1 M2 M3 M4 M5
The selector lever position is indicated, and in
the manual mode the gear currently engaged.

Changing selector lever positions

>

The selector lever can be moved out of the
position P when the ignition is switched on
or the engine is running: interlock.

>

When the vehicle is stationary, step on the
brake before shifting out of P or N; other-
wise, the selector lever is locked: shiftlock.

To prevent the vehicle from creeping
after you select a drive position, main-

tain pressure on the brake pedal until you
are ready to start driving.

<

A lock prevents the selector lever from being
inadvertently moved into positions R and P. To
release the lock, press the button on the front of
the selector lever handle, refer to arrow.

P Park

Select only when the vehicle is stationary. The
transmission locks to prevent the rear wheels
from turning.
